Kolkata: Morning walk is not safe now in & around VICTORIA MEMORIAL at the City of Joy. A Research study conducted by well renowned Kolkata based environmental organization SMG – HAI engaged in AIR POLLUTION matters published the following report on 1st Nov 2013 after scrutiny the data from wbpcb source.
TIME- 4AM TO 8AM SPM level (PM10) NO2 LEVEL (mg/m3)
4am 247mg/m3 130 mg
5am 229 117
6am 223 97
7am 218 88
8am 220 93
average level ………………………. 227 105
THE PERMISSIBLE LIMIT — 100mg/m3 80mg/m3
This zone is most sensitive having heritage buildings, hospital, church etc but no more safe now from air pollution point of view.
Mr. Somendra Mohan Ghosh, Green technologist & Environmentalist said, “Environmental Impact Assessment (E I A) on Air Pollution is urgently needed at EDEN GARDEN also before the test match. Some years back England team refused to play due to excessive pollution.”
He also noted the fact that skill & performances depends on fresh air generation during cricket, football, hockey matches. Stamina may hamper of an athletic in a polluted zone. Although No Air Pollution Monitoring is done before the International Cricket Match.
